APP下载

基于B/S的影院在线选座设计

2018-02-24刘晓萌

电脑知识与技术 2018年34期
关键词:购票选票座位

刘晓萌

摘要:在互联网尚未发展成熟之前,人们看场电影之前需要专门前去影院买票,极其不方便,如今,基于B/S的电影院在线选票系统的出现,用户可以在网页上完成选择想观看的电影、了解电影详情以及选座购票等一系列操作。该论文主要研究影院购票系统实现,对其选座功能进行主要研究,如何动态选取座位、选取自己想要座位。

关键词:互联网;B/S;选票系统

中图分类号:TP311     文献标识码:A     文章编号:1009-3044(2018)34-0064-02

如今科学技术的发展越发火热,高端的技术层出不穷。尤其是互联网技术的到来, 使我们的生活发生了质的变化。如今,在Internet普遍普及的情况下,基于B/S的电影院在线选票系统的出现,用户可以在网页上完成选择想观看的电影、了解电影详情以及选座购票等一系列操作[1]。用户想看什么电影,想要什么座位,只需轻松点几下网页即能很快完成。传统的在售票处售票将会被逐渐取代。

本论文主要研究影院购票的实现,对其选座功能进行主要研究,如何动态选取座位、选取自己想要座位。

1选座模块设计思路

选座界面的动态实现主要采用了JavaScript技术[2],数据的处理同样使用Servlet。每个影院座位有相应座位表,座位表中有相应的座位状态,在页面加载时,根据相应的座位状态来加载座位,若座位已经被选过,则状态为2,页面加载时座位为红色,其他用户无法选中。反之未选中的座位为白色。在用户选座过程中,当用户点击时(选取座位),座位状态为1(绿色),当用户再次点击时(取消选中),座位状态变为0(白色),用户选取座位超过5个时,则无法继续选取,并弹窗提醒用户一次只能购买5个座位。座位在后台可以控制其排布情况(见后台管理部分),当座位状态为3时,页面座位显示为空白。用户在确认选座后则会生成相应的订单信息,支付成功后即可完成购票。选座界面如图1所示。

3选座测试

用户点击座位则座位图标变为绿色,座位若为红色表示已有用户购买,无法点击。当用户选取座位时,用下方会显示座位信息以及价格和票数信息,用户若选取超过5个,则会提示只能购买5张票[3]。如图5所示。

4总结

传统的前往电影院购票,给人极大的不便,而如今只需打开网页即可浏览到最新电影详情,选座、订票等一体化实现,符合如今信息时代发展趋势,也给人焕然一新的体验感。

基于B/S的影院在线选座系统实现了用户足不出户,即可购买想看的电影,以及浏览最新电影情况,用户只需通过浏览器进行简单操作即可成功購买喜欢的电影,不仅减少了影院工作人员的工作量,也更加简单高效的使用户体验观看影片乐趣[4]。

参考文献:

[1] 唐钰龙, 孙洋洋. 浅析中国在线电影票务平台的发展困境与对策[J]. 青年时代, 2017(22).

[2] 刘伟, 张利国. Java Web开发与实战:Eclipse+Tomcat+Servlet+JSP整合应用[M]. 北京:科学出版社, 2008.

[3] 金景文化. HTML+CSS+JavaScript网页设计实用教程[M]. 北京:人民邮电出版社, 2015.

[4] 黄文博, 燕杨. C/S结构与B/S结构的分析与比较[J]. 长春师范大学学报, 2006, 25(8):56-58.

【通联编辑:梁书】

猜你喜欢

购票选票座位
超幸运!安阳购彩者机选票“邂逅”1800万大奖
不同的购票方法
换座位
直击痛点的“候补购票”可多来一些
铁路候补购票服务扩大到全部列车